Teaching Personnel is seeking a resilient and dedicated SEN Pupil Development Mentor to join a specialist school in Bridgend, supporting pupils aged 3–19.

This is a hands-on, rewarding role where every day brings the chance to make a real impact on a child’s learning and personal development. You’ll work 1:1 with pupils, helping them access the curriculum while supporting their social, emotional, and behavioural development.

The ideal candidate is patient, adaptable, and confident in building positive relationships. You should be able to stay calm under pressure and use effective strategies to manage challenging situations. Flexibility is essential, as you will be working with pupils across a wide range of ages and abilities. Your resilience and positive approach will help create a safe, nurturing environment where pupils can thrive.


What We’re Looking For

  • Experience supporting children or young people with SEN and challenging behaviours, or experience in care, or youth support settings is desirable.
  • Ability to provide consistent 1:1 and small group support
  • Effective behaviour management and de-escalation strategies
  • Commitment to fostering engagement, confidence, and emotional development
  • Willingness to assist with mobility and sensory needs

✅Requirements (or willingness to obtain at own cost)

  • Must be 18 or over
  • Registration with the Education Workforce Council (EWC)
  • Enhanced DBS on the Update Service
  • Level 2 Safeguarding training
  • Two professional references covering 24 months of employment
